Redline Group Ltd is collaborating with a client in Stamford, Lincolnshire to find multiple Contract Manufacturing Engineers. You will join a world-class team focused on lean manufacturing transformation and drive process change. Candidates with experience in lean processes and industrial environments will excel in this role. This position requires working through an Umbrella company and offers the opportunity to impact meaningful change in manufacturing practices.
